Where does “Hvaranin” come from?
Hvaranin (Serbo-Croatian) comes from Serbo-Croatian Hvȃr, from Ancient Greek φάρος, from Ancient Greek φᾶρος — large piece of cloth, web; wide cloak or mantle...
